Grilled Shrimp Foil Packs

  • Total Time: 30 minutes
  • Yield: 4 servings 1x

Description

Delicious and easy grilled shrimp foil packs with baby potatoes and corn, seasoned with Old Bay.


Ingredients

  • 1 pound large shrimp (peeled and deveined)
  • 1 pound baby potatoes (halved)
  • 2 ears corn (cut into thirds)
  • 1 tablespoon Old Bay seasoning
  • 4 tablespoons butter (melted)
  • 1 lemon juice (freshly squeezed)
  • 2 cloves garlic (minced)

Instructions

  1. Preheat the grill to medium-high heat.
  2. In a large bowl, combine shrimp, potatoes, corn, Old Bay seasoning, melted butter, lemon juice, and garlic.
  3. Cut four large pieces of aluminum foil and divide the shrimp mixture evenly among them.
  4. Fold the foil over the mixture to create sealed packets.
  5. Place the foil packs on the grill and cook for about 15-20 minutes, or until the shrimp are pink and the potatoes are tender.
  6. Carefully open the foil packs, allowing steam to escape.
  7. Serve immediately with additional lemon wedges if desired.

Notes

  • For a spicier kick, add red pepper flakes to the shrimp mixture.
  • You can customize vegetables based on what you have on hand.
